
В ситуациях, когда на сайте нужно отследить не просто отправку формы с сайта, а чуть сложнее, например, последовательность действий пользователя, то в таких случаях без составной цели в Google Analitics не обойтись. Сегодня вы научитесь самостоятельно делать такие цели.
План действий:
- Определяем последовательность действий, которою будем отслеживать. Это будет нашей целью.
- Создаем “Виртуальную страницу” и вешаем ее на кнопку.
- Создаем в Google Analitics делаем составную цель
Воронка событий
В качестве примера будет отслеживать следующую цепочку действий: пользователь заходит на сайт, кликает на кнопку “Обратная связь”, далее открывает всплывающее окно с формой и кнопкой “Отправить заявку”. Вот эту последовательность и будем отслеживать.
Так как посещение сайта можно не учитывать, так как это делаю все пользователи вашего сайта. Без этого они просто бы не увидели ваш сайт. Остается еще 2 действия: клик по кнопке “Обратная связь” и клик по кнопке в форме “Отправить заявку”.
Стоит сразу обратить внимание, что Google Analitics при составной цели работает исключительно со страницами. То есть взаимодействуя с кнопкой и формой я работаю с виртуальными страницами.
Что такое виртуальная страница в Google Analitics?
С помощью виртуальной страницы можно показать Google Analitics, что пользователь сделал переход на страницу, которой на самом деле физически не существует. Эта самая виртуальная страница и будет целью для нас.
В нашем случае нажатие кнопки “Обратная связь” это промежуточная цель, а отправка формы это – финальная цель.
Рассмотрим синтаксис составной цели
«Send» (отправить), «Page view» (показать страницу) и далее идет название страницы.
Чтобы обратиться к виртуальной странице нужно использовать «Onsubmit» – для отправки формы и «Onclick» – для кнопки.
Получаем готовые коды для вставки на сайт.
ga(‘send’, ‘pageview’, ‘/virtualpage-click’) – на промежуточную цель (кнопка “Обратная связь”)
ga(‘send’, ‘pageview’, ‘/virtualpage-submit’) – на финальную цель (Отправка формы)
Чтобы не загромождать пост лишним, специально выше выдали сразу готовый вариант для использования.
Настройка составной цели в Google Analitics
Переходим в Google Analitics, администрирование, цели и создаем новую цель. Выбираем далее “Собственная”. Теперь указываем название цели и выбираем “Целевая страница”.
В поле “Переход” ставим равно и указываем нашу финальную виртуальную страницу. Далее включаем “Последовательность” и заполняем открывшееся поле (название и промежуточная виртуальная страница). На скрине выше уже заполненный вариант. Все, готово, составная цель настроена.
П. С. Шагов может быть сколько угодно, делается все по аналогии с данной инструкцией.